How they compare

Peru currently reports 49.2% against 48.6% in Sweden, a difference of 0.6%.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Sweden ahead.

Peru ranks 119th and Sweden ranks 121st of 169 countries.

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Peru Sweden Difference Ahead
2000s 58.0% 65.0% 7.1% Sweden
2010s 46.4% 53.4% 7.1% Sweden
2020s 47.9% 51.1% 3.2% Sweden

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Raw data are from Bankscope. Data2090 / (data2080 + data2085). All Numerator and denominator are first aggregated on the country level before division. Note that banks used in the calculation might differ between indicators. Calculated from underlying bank-by-bank unconsolidated data from Bankscope.
